🧬 Microvilli vs Cilia — Why They’re Found in Specific Systems
📌 Microvilli: Where & Why?
Found in: Digestive, Urinary, and Reproductive Tracts
Function: Absorption and surface area enhancement.
Why only here? These systems need to absorb nutrients (digestive), reabsorb water/ions (urinary), or secrete/absorb substances (reproductive). Microvilli are microscopic finger-like projections of the plasma membrane that maximize surface area for efficient absorption.
🔬 Example: Small intestine epithelial cells are densely packed with microvilli for nutrient absorption.
🌬️ Cilia: Where & Why?
Found in: Respiratory and Reproductive Tracts
Function: Movement of mucus, fluid, or gametes.
Why only here? Cilia are hair-like motile structures that beat rhythmically to move substances along the surface. In the respiratory tract, they push mucus and trapped particles out. In the female reproductive tract, they help in egg transport through fallopian tubes.
🔬 Example: Tracheal epithelium has cilia that sweep out dust and pathogens.
🧠 Assertion & Reason Style Question (NEET-style)
Assertion (A): Microvilli are found in epithelial cells of the digestive tract.
Reason (R): Microvilli help in absorption by increasing the surface area of the plasma membrane.
- Both A and R are true and R is the correct explanation of A.
- Both A and R are true but R is not the correct explanation of A.
- A is true but R is false.
- A is false but R is true.
✅ Correct Answer: A
✔️ Both statements are true and directly linked — microvilli increase the surface area, enabling higher absorption which is crucial in the digestive tract.
🧪 Summary Table
Feature | Microvilli | Cilia |
---|---|---|
Found In | Digestive, Urinary, Reproductive | Respiratory, Reproductive |
Function | Absorption (↑ surface area) | Movement (mucus, ovum) |
Motion | Non-motile | Motile |
Structure | Actin filament core | Microtubule (9+2) core |
